1. Economist CAMRIS International is an international development
and research firm that realizes innovative solutions to health and development challenges through high-quality, cost-effective program and research management services. With experience working in more than 80 countries, we combine our proven systems with today’s most effective, evidence-based best practices to improve the lives of people around the world. We apply a customized, customer-centric, cost-effective business approach to offer greater value to our clients and challenge the way things have always been done in our field.
CAMRIS clients include U.S. government agencies and multilateral and private organizations. Our core practice areas include public health, agriculture and food security, economic development, education, environment, humanitarian assistance, democracy and governance, and medical research.
CAMRIS International is seeking an Economist for an upcoming indefinite delivery, indefinite quantity (IDIQ) contract to provide support services to improve data-driven decision making, planning, and implementation for USAID/Tanzania and its implementing partners and local partners, including the National Bureau for Statistics and other Tanzanian institutions.
Note: This position is contingent on contract award.
Responsibilities
  • Assist with the design, planning, and implementation of the evaluation throughout the project’s three phases.
  • Liaise with USAID staff, implementing partners, and other project stakeholders.
  • Provide staff with data analysis training.
  • Mentor junior staff.

Qualifications:

  • PhD in economics, international development, social science, or a related field.
  • At least 10+ years of professional experience and an understanding of issues related to sustainable economic development.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, supervision, and management skills.
  • Ability to work with and lead diverse teams.
  • Fluency in written and spoken English and Kiswahili is required.
  • East Africa experience is considered a plus.
  • Experience with USAID is preferred.

National Director at TAFES- Tanzania Fellowship of Evangelical Students

Image result for National Director at TAFES- Tanzania Fellowship of Evangelical Students





 
Tanzania Fellowship of Evangelical Students (TAFES) is a Christian-based organization that was, registered in Tanzania in June 1990. TAFES is affiliated to the International Fellowship of Evangelical Students (IFES). TAFES aims at reaching students with the gospel of Jesus Christ and it equips University and College students with the Scripture in Evangelism, Discipleship and Leadership Development thereby transforming the Campus, Church and the Society.
TAFES is seeking to recruit a suitable and qualified person to fill the post of NATIONAL DIRECTOR (ND) to be based in its Head office in Dar es Salaam. The overall job purpose is to provide leadership and strategic direction forTAFES.The ND shall, upon TAFES Governing Council (TGC) approval, be responsible for all policy formulation and implementation, resource mobilization, performance management as well as partnerships and networks to ensure that the TAFES vision, mission and objectives are achieved. Detailed role profile including duties and job responsibilities can be requested through the email indicated below.
Job Qualifications:
The candidate should be a holder of a Bachelor Degree and/or Possession of a post graduate qualification. S/he must be a Born again Christian with at least three years experience of working in Interdenominational Christian fellowships preferably in Universities and Colleges. The incumbent should have an understanding of TAFES and be committed to its vision, mission and core values. The candidate should have strong soft skills, leadership character and be computer literate.
